Payment information
4.7. We use WorldPay to process payments you make using one of our websites or in our speciality vape retail store. WorldPay operate a secure server to process your payment details. WorldPay encrypt your credit, debit card or PayPal account information and authorises payment directly. Any payment transactions will be stored on WorldPay hosting services.
4.8. This means that your credit card, debit card, or PayPal account details are never revealed to us.

Cookies
4.10. Like many online services, we use a feature called a 'cookie', which is a small data file that is sent to your browser from a web server and stored on your device's hard drive. We also use a feature called a ‘pixel’ , which is code that we place on our websites to collect data about ‘pixel events’. ‘Pixel events’ are actions that happen on our websites, such as adding items to your cart or signing up for our newsletter. References in this Privacy Policy to ‘cookies’ also include other means of automatically accessing or storing information on your device.
4.11. Cookies enable us to provide you with a better experience by enabling our websites to recognise that you have visited before and in some cases to record preferences to personalise your visit. Cookies also assist us to analyse the profile of our visitors and how you use our websites.
4.12. Sometimes we partner with third parties (such as advertising and social media partners) who may place a cookie (or cause a pixel event to trigger) on your device when you visit our websites to remember that you have visited our websites. This means that when you later visit another website, the advertisements displayed to you may be advertisements for our websites or products or about other products and services that are tailored to your apparent interests. If you click on one of our advertisements, it will redirect you back to one of our websites. Our third-party partners may provide us with information about the total number of views, shares, and click-throughs these advertisements have received. However, they will not collect or provide to us or any other third party any information that identifies you.
4.13. To delete or stop cookies being placed (or pixel events triggering) on your computer, refer to the help menu on your internet browser. In some cases, blocking cookies and pixels may reduce the functionality of our websites or otherwise prevent access to them depending on your chosen browser options. Verifying your age
5.7. If you use any of our websites or visit our speciality vape retail store, you will be asked to confirm that you are 18 years or over and we may keep a record of that confirmation.
5.8. We may take additional steps to verify that you are aged 18 years or over before we supply any products to you. To enable us to do this we will require certain information about you. This information will then be passed to our identity verification service provider who will check it against public sources of information to deliver confirmation of your identity and age. To verify your identity, we may also require you to provide:

(a) demographic information (such as gender and birth date); and
(b) personally identifiable information (such as your passport number or driving licence number) which may be used by our identity verification service provider to verify your details.

This information is checked against secure independent data sources to help verify identity.
5.9. In some cases, we may need to ask for further information to verify your age. If this is necessary, we will contact you to explain why.
5.10. Failing age verification will mean you cannot complete a purchase.
5.11. All information we collect from you for verifying your age will be used, held and disclosed by us under this Privacy Policy.
